The Influence Of RMB Internationalization On China’s Service Trade

With the deepening of foreign cooperation,China has become the second largest economy and the largest trader of goods all over the world,and foreign trade has become an important growth pole of China’s economy.However,China’s trade structure is unreasonable,and there is a large deficit in service trade,which hinders the optimization and upgrading of the trade structure.In recent years,the voice for promoting the internationalization of the RMB has become more and more intense.In practice,the internationalization of the RMB has promoted the growth of export trade.Therefore,it is necessary to explore whether the internationalization of RMB can promote China’s service trade exports.This paper firstly sorts out the relevant research at home and abroad,and analyzes the development and current situation of RMB internationalization.Second,build a regression model to estimate the scale of RMB overseas circulation and calculate the RMB internationalization index.Then,using the calculated RMB internationalization index,etc.,combined with the bilateral trade data between China and 13 trading partners,a panel model is constructed for analysis.It is found that the internationalization of RMB has a promoting effect on the export trade of service industry.This paper also puts forward relevant suggestions.The potential innovation of this paper is to calculate the RMB internationalization index through indirect measurement method;and to analyze its impact on China’s service trade from the process of RMB internationalization.In addition,from the perspective of empirical analysis,it complements the discussion on RMB internationalization and China’s service trade relationship in this field.
